Reservations for a similar Union project, Airflight to Nassau, are also being taken, Balgley said. He added that adequate room is still available, and the deadline for obtaining tickets for the Nassau trip is Feb. 24. The plane will leave Detroit in the late afternoon of March 31, will arrive in Nassau four hours later. It will return on April 8. The cost of the trip, $175, in- cludes plane fare and lodgings. Double and triple rooms in almost adjacent hotels will house the party. Fein To Lecture On Mental Illness Prof. Rashi Fein of the Univer- sity of North Carolina will speak on "Measuring the Value of Hu- man Resources: Mental Illness, A Case Study," at 4 p.m. today in Rackham Ampitheatre. The lec- ture is sponsored by the economics department and the public health' school. PERSONAL "Time goes, you say? Ah not Alas, time stays, we go."
